For those planning to purchase tickets, Dagenham Dock offers the convenience of a ticket office that operates from Monday to Friday between 06:15 and 09:50. While the station might not operate ticket counters throughout Saturday and Sunday, it does offer ticket machines that function round the clock, ensuring you have access to purchase or collect tickets bought online reliably. The accessible ticket machines alongside smartcard validators make traveling convenient for all passengers.
While there are no staff members to assist you directly onsite, Dagenham Dock is decked out with customer help points and essential departure screens keeping you informed on the latest train schedules. Should you need additional customer service assistance, reach out via their contact services operational Monday through Friday during business hours.
Despite being a smaller station, the emphasis on accessibility is apparent with facilities like step-free access, induction loops, and accessible car park spaces with a couple of dedicated spots close to the entrance. However, amenities like waiting rooms, seating areas, or refreshment outlets are not available, BUT essentials like CCTV coverage do ensure your safety. It is also reassuring to know that the public Wi-Fi is available for travelers looking to stay connected on the move.
Dagenham Dock provides simple yet effective transport links with options like the TfL 145 Bus service that connects travelers towards Barking, Rainham, and Grays, running adjacent to the Ford Stamping Plant. While Risca & Pontymister station may not be the largest or the busiest of the Welsh train stations, it caters well to its daily travelers. Although there is no ticket office, purchasing tickets is straightforward with the ticket machines available on site. These machines are equipped for accessibility, ensuring everyone can easily collect tickets purchased online.
No first-class lounges or shops await you here, but you do have the essentials like CCTV for security and a seating area for those wait-time moments. While waiting, take advantage of pertinent information on display screens and listen to announcements to keep up with your train schedules.
Risca & Pontymister station makes commendable efforts to accommodate passengers with different needs. The presence of ramps makes stepping onto trains easier for those with mobility challenges, and there are customer help points to assist you when needed. However, bear in mind that while there is step-free access to Platform 1 from the car park, reaching Platform 2 requires a longer detour.
Accessible parking is available, with six designated spaces and no parking charges to worry about—making this station a hassle-free zone for car drivers and cyclists alike. With bicycle lockers available, your two-wheeled friend is safe here too.
The lack of in-station refreshment facilities or ATMs means you'll need to prepare ahead of your journey or plan a visit to nearby amenities. Yet, the station is well-connected to external transport options. Local buses can be accessed at the Maryland Road stop, which also serves as the rail replacement bus point should you need it. If you're looking to bike around once you arrive, keep in mind there are no cycle hire facilities on site.
